Did it look like the photo/drawing on the pattern envelope once you were done sewing with it? Yes, I believe so.
Were the instructions easy to follow? Yes.
What did you particularly like or dislike about the pattern? I liked the pattern and my only complaints would be trying to get the 1/4" wide cord through the 1/4" wide double fold bias tape called for in the notions section of the pattern envelope. I'm still wondering if I got the wrong size bias tape. I hand sewed the cord in, never ever had to do that before.
Fabric Used: gingham cotton
Pattern alterations or any design changes you made: none
Would you sew it again? Would you recommend it to others? Certainly
Conclusion: It's a more fitted version of a peasant blouse and I dream up every kind of possible type of fabric I could use. It's really a nice pattern and I'm comfortable with the results. It's actually been off the hanger for lots occasions, can't say that for all my "creations".
